3. Real Estate Market
The real estate market in Sarasota Beach is highly desirable and competitive, reflecting its status as a premier coastal location. The housing stock is diverse, ranging from luxurious Gulf-front estates and modern condominium towers with panoramic views to charming, renovated cottages on shaded inland streets. Waterfront properties, whether direct Gulf access or on quiet canals, are particularly sought after.
This demand is reflected in the market values. The median home value in the area is approximately $877,400, with many properties significantly exceeding this figure. The market caters to a discerning buyer, and properties often feature high-end finishes, hurricane-resistant construction, and premium amenities. The substantial median household income of $121,006 underscores the financial stability of the community and its capacity to invest in this exceptional lifestyle.

5. Transportation & Connectivity
Sarasota Beach is conveniently connected to the greater Sarasota region and beyond. While the island itself encourages a leisurely pace, major arteries like the John Ringling Causeway and Stickney Point Road provide quick access to downtown Sarasota, the Sarasota Bradenton International Airport (SRQ), and Interstate 75. SRQ offers a growing number of direct flights, making travel convenient for residents.
Within the neighborhood, many residents opt for golf carts, bicycles, or walking to navigate the village and beach accesses, adding to the casual, vacation-like feel. Public transportation via the Sarasota County Area Transit (SCAT) bus system serves the key, and ride-sharing services are readily available. For boat owners, the extensive intracoastal waterway system provides a scenic "highway" to other coastal communities, restaurants, and destinations.

Sarasota Beach Market Data
| Metric | Value |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$877K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Gross Rent | $2K/mo |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Household Income | $121K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Homeownership Rate | 87.3%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Renter-Occupied | 12.7%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Rental Vacancy Rate | 70.4%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Market Type | Buyer's |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Primary ZIP Code | 34242 |
